Broad Research Theme of the Lab:

The principal research interest of the lab is to comprehensively understand the biology of specific cancer types that are common in India

and distinct from their western counterpart(s). Based on results obtained from 25 years of work performed on patient-derived colorectal, pancreatic, esophageal and oral tumor samples, we are presently studying the canonical and aberrant functions of chromatin remodelers ARID1B and ARID2. In parallel, based on funding from the DBT- Wellcome Trust India Alliance, we are using genomics and cutting edge molecular / cellular / clinic-pathological approaches to comprehensively characterize early-onset colorectal cancer in the Indian population.
